Fender Classic 60's Jazz - Seymour Duncan Antiquity II

Sign in to disble this ad
Fender Classic 60's Jazz bass, sunburst/rosewood, MIM 2002. Has its share of dings, true player wear, nothing terrible. Sounds better than my other Jazzes, but I need to thin the herd, and burst is not my favorite color.

Upgrades:
Seymour Duncan Antiquity II pickups
Graphtech Tusq nut
Fender tort pickguard

Weight I would estimate at 9.5 pounds. DR Sunbeams still in good shape + budget gigbag.

I have two of these with Antiquity IIs, and they are great basses. I sold my 2008 MIA Jazz bass and kept these, because they sounded and played better, IMO. I also added Gotoh Res-o-lite direct replacement tuners, because I couldn't get used to the reverse tuners, so that's another upgrade option, for those who care. Good price, too.
